Marriott
Just inked a new $13.6B deal with Starwood Hotels, after Starwood received an outside counter-offer. The merger will create the largest hotel company in the world.
Apple
Will hold its spring event today, just before tomorrow's privacy hearing. We can expect a smaller iPhone and a smaller iPad Pro.
Cuba
President Obama, the first sitting president to visit Cuba in nearly 90 years, landed yesterday. Starwood also announced that it will run three Cuban hotels, the first American business to do so in 60 years.
Twitter
Turns ten today. On Friday Jack Dorsey assured users that its iconic 140-character limit won't be going anywhere.
